Use a list to help you pack your essentials. Well in advance, you need to craft a clear list of everything that you are going to need. Even if you put off packing until the last minute, you can look at your list to avoid taking too much, or worse, forgetting something vital.

Exercise before you get on the airplane. Long flights are found to be hard to sit through. Sitting in one position for a long period of time can cramp up your legs and back. You can have more energy at the end of your flight when your warm up and stretch before takeoff.

Always check expiration dates on of all of your passports. Most countries have passport regulations with which you must comply. If your passport expires within a specified time frame, you may not be able to enter the country. Time frames can run anywhere from three months to a year.

Consider drinking only bottled water if you are traveling to another country. Many countries do not purify their drinking water and this water can cause many different illnesses. Use bottled water to brush your teeth with. Although it may seem inconsequential, you could get sick even from the small amount of water used when you brush your teeth.

Do not go to a currency exchange if you can help it. There are better ways to get your hands on foreign currency. You can use your debit card at foreign ATM machines for cash without the conversion charge. They have better exchange rates and are generally cheap than exchanges.

Make copies of anything important before you travel. Copies of important papers like your passport, insurance forms, and any other key documentation should travel well-separated from your originals. It is also a good idea to leave a set with a friend or relative in case all the sets you have are lost or stolen.
